Lincoln Little League is a recreational league established for kids in the city of Lincoln.
Our purpose is to provide a safe and healthy environment for children to develop teamwork, sportsmanship, and fair play. |

Fall Ball Registration: Begins on Monday, July 15. Fall Ball is an instructional league for AA, AAA, and Majors. Players with plans to move up into these leagues, and those who want to continue to develop their skills at these levels, are encouraged to participate. Fall Ball Season starts in late August - early September, and usually ends by early November. Games are scheduled with Rocklin and Tri-City leagues. Registration will be on-line only. |

Little League mandates certain material and size specification requirements on all bats.
Before using any bat or buying a bat for your player, please review the information on this link:
http://www.littleleague.org/learn/equipment/baseballbatinfo.htm
No other bats outside of these requirements will be allowed at Practices or Games.
Requirements covering Majors (and below) divisions are different than requirements for the Juniors division. |
